Print Okren 3 is a bold, narrow, medium contrast, italic, normal x-height font.

A lively handwritten print with a right-leaning, brushy construction and chunky strokes. Forms are rounded and slightly condensed, with soft, swelling curves and tapered joins that suggest a marker or brush-pen tool. The rhythm is irregular in an intentional, hand-drawn way—counters vary subtly, bowls are full, and terminals often finish with a gentle hook or flare. Capitals are compact and animated, while the lowercase shows a bouncy baseline and simplified, single-story shapes that keep the texture informal and approachable.
Best suited to short, attention-getting text such as posters, packaging callouts, greeting cards, and social media graphics where warmth and informality are desired. It also works well for kid-focused or playful branding, labels, and event materials, especially when set at medium-to-large sizes.
The overall tone is upbeat and personable, with a spontaneous, human feel that reads as friendly rather than formal. Its energetic slant and slightly quirky proportions give it a chatty voice suited to lighthearted messaging and expressive headlines.
The design appears intended to capture the immediacy of hand-lettered print—clean enough to read quickly, but irregular enough to feel personal. Its goal is an expressive, friendly texture for display typography rather than a strictly uniform, bookish reading face.
The numerals echo the same rounded, hand-inked personality, with soft curves and slightly uneven widths that maintain the drawn texture. Stroke endings and inner spaces remain open enough for display sizes, but the busy, brushy texture can feel dense in long paragraphs at smaller sizes.
